The map cannot show the quality of your drinking water. For that, you will have to contact your waterworks. See map of groundwater analyses. Here you will be able to find information about the drinking water hardness in your municipality.
The map shows the drinking water hardness in as an average per municipality measured at the individual waterworks. Hardness is based on the concentration of calcium and magnesium in the water. Hardness is important for the dosage of soap when washing for instance clothes: hard water requires more soap than soft water. The water hardness may vary considerably from waterwork to waterwork within the municipality. Contact your local waterwork to get the updated and precise figures. See map of drinking water hardness.
